What to Do If You Receive a Call from 03 9022 7525

If 03 9022 7525 calls you:

  • Do not: Provide your IP address, device name, remote access credentials, or any technical information
  • Do not: Allow the caller to connect remotely to your computer or network
  • Do not: Transfer payment or provide banking details
  • Do: Hang up immediately if the caller becomes rude or pressuring
  • Do: Verify directly with Telstra by calling their official number 13 2200 or visiting telstra.com.au
  • Do: Block 0390227525 on your phone after the call ends
  • Do: Never call back numbers provided by unsolicited callers

Legitimate Telstra staff will never ask for IP addresses unsolicited or pressure you into providing technical access to your devices.

How to Report 03 9022 7525

If you receive a scam call from this number:

  • Report to Scamwatch at scamwatch.gov.au with details of what was requested
  • Report to the Australian Communications and Media Authority (ACMA) at acma.gov.au
  • Contact Telstra directly at 13 2200 to report the impersonation
  • Report to ReportCyber at cyber.gov.au if any remote access occurred
  • Block the number 03 9022 7525 or 0390227525 on your phone to prevent future contact

Frequently Asked Questions

Why would a scammer ask for my IP address?

Scammers requesting IP addresses like those calling from 03 9022 7525 typically use this information to either gain remote access to your device, create a false sense of technical legitimacy, or combine it with other stolen data for identity theft. Real Telstra staff never request IP addresses unsolicited.

Should I call 03 9022 7525 back if I missed the call?

No. Do not call back 0390227525 or any unsolicited number. If Telstra needs to contact you about a genuine issue, they will call again or you can reach them directly at 13 2200.

How can I verify if this is really Telstra calling?

Never trust caller ID or the caller's word. If someone claiming to be from Telstra calls about your account, hang up and call Telstra directly on 13 2200 or visit telstra.com.au. This is the safest way to verify any claim from 03 9022 7525.

What should I do if I already gave my IP address to this caller?

Do not panic, but take action. Immediately change your WiFi password, update your device passwords, and monitor your accounts for unusual activity. Consider reporting to ReportCyber at cyber.gov.au if you're concerned about remote access.
